Instant Public Interest Litigation is filed seeking the following reliefs:-
“I. To iss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 order or direction to respondents to frame or amend rules to provide interim pay out upto 75% of the retirement benefit commensurating with the number of years of practice having on the credit of an advocate to mitigate the sufferings of practicing advocates on account of Covid-19 pandemic;
II. To iss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 order or direction to 1st respondent to pay the entire outstanding contribution from Legal Benefit Fund towards share of Welfare Fund or Bar Council of Kerala within such time fixed by this Hon’ble Court;
III. Such other reliefs as this Hon’ble Court may deem fit and proper in the facts and circumstances of the case.”
